Job description

Job Summary

Uses advanced skills typically gained through a combination of training and considerable on-the-job experience to represent the quality of all products of HMH’s Lifecycle Services origin. Provide technical assistance to clients and perform/oversee field installations and repairs.

Job Responsibilities
  • Typically acts as a lead, coordinating and checking the work of others – but not as a supervisor
  • Provide technical support, mentoring & training for all less experienced Service Engineers and external clients.
  • Perform all work in accordance with HMH Lifecycle Services and client safety policies.
  • Provide installation, commissioning, troubleshooting and repair services in shop or field environment on HMH’s Lifecycle Services equipment.
  • Coordinate with the Operations/ DLS Manager and the Service Account Manager for onsite required parts, materials, support, etc.
  • Advise client of any modifications or upgrades to HMH’s Lifecycle Services equipment.
  • Supervision of subcontracted personnel.
  • Participate in the Workshop and the Overhaul activities and coordinate with Overhaul Supervisor in regard to workshop tasks and activities
  • Understands key business drivers and how it impacts the work of the team.
  • Allocates work and provides subject matter guidance to other team members
  • Exercises judgment, based on previous experience, practices and precedents, to identify and solve unique problems in the field.
  • Prepare recommended electrical spare parts list for overhaul projects at the workshop.
  • Prepare an accurate and detailed inspection report after damage assessment and be accountable for the all the provided inputs in the report.
  • Report any additional scope of work or variations from standard overhaul scope of work.
  • Upload all reports, timesheet, CSF’s and expense reports to the job folder.
  • Advise client of modifications, bulletins or upgrades to HMH’s Lifecycle Services equipment
  • Impacts the effectiveness of own team and closely related teams
  • Promote personal accountability for Health, Safety, Security, and Environment (HSSE) by adhering to the principles and guidelines outlined in HMH's HSSE governing policy.
  • Document all services performed, and actions carried out on service and time tickets.
  • Stay current on information contained in Product and Safety Bulletins.
  • Stay current on information with drilling procedures and ensure that all work performed is handled according to procedures and guidelines.
  • Support all the company’s objectives.
  • Interact with customers and other HMH personnel in a professional manner.
  • Be guided by HMH Visions and Values in all activities
Required Qualifications

Education: BS or higher in an Electrical Engineering discipline.

Experience: Minimum 5 years of relevant experience; 2+ years experience in installation, factory training with Siemens & ABB software handling, troubleshooting, and programming; proficient in electrical circuits and components; proficient in basic hydraulic circuits and components; ability to read schematic and layout drawings; proficient with software updating, installation, and troubleshooting; proficient at PLC operation and programming; provides authoritative advice and expertise to diagnose, investigate and provide solutions to moderately complex problems, troubleshooting and repair of Oil Drilling Equipment or similar electrically operated equipment.
